在标记语言文档中支持数字墨水制造技术

技术编号:16308053 阅读:62 留言:0更新日期:2017-09-27 01:57
计算设备上的应用包括支持在标记语言文档中输入和输出数字墨水的数字墨水系统。数字墨水指的是可以被显示在输出设备上的在输入设备上的物体(例如笔或手指)笔划的数字表示。标记语言文档例如可以包括可以在其中输入数字墨水以及可选地其他数据的编辑框。随着输入物体在输入设备之上移动,标识出输入物体的位置的数据被捕获并且被嵌入在文档的标记语言元素中。所述数字墨水系统还允许显示包括数字墨水的文档,其中数字墨水系统将数字墨水连同包括在文档中的任何其他数据一起显示。

Supporting digital ink in markup language documents

Applications on computing devices include digital ink systems that support the input and output of digital ink in markup language documents. Digital ink refers to a digital representation of an object (such as a pen or finger) that is displayed on an input device that can be displayed on an output device. A markup language document, for example, may include an edit box in which digital ink can be entered and optionally other data. As the input object moves over the input device, data identifying the position of the input object is captured and embedded in the markup language element of the document. The digital ink system also allows display of documents including digital ink, wherein the digital ink system displays digital ink together with any other data included in the document.

【技术实现步骤摘要】
【国外来华专利技术】在标记语言文档中支持数字墨水
技术介绍
随着计算技术的进步,许多不同类型的计算设备变得可用,比如膝上型计算机、平板计算机、智能电话等等。这些设备当中的一些接受输入,从而允许用户例如通过使用笔或手指写字而在设备上进行书写或绘画。虽然许多用户喜欢在设备上进行书写或绘画的能力,但是允许这样的输入并不是没有其问题。这方面的一个问题是可能难以把通过这样的输入所提供的数据合并到正由用户编辑或创建的文档中,从而导致用户对于其设备感到挫折。
技术实现思路
提供本
技术实现思路
是为了以简化形式介绍将在后面的具体实施方式部分中进一步描述的概念的选择。本
技术实现思路
不意图标识出所要求保护的主题内容的关键特征或必要特征,也不意图被用来限制所要求保护的主题内容的范围。根据一个或多个方面,由应用接收针对标记语言文档的数字墨水用户输入。生成包括描述数字墨水用户输入的数据的数字墨水标记语言元素,并且把数字墨水标记语言元素嵌入在标记语言文档中。标记语言文档还在一个或多个附加元素中包括附加数据,所述附加数据描述在显示标记语言文档时将显示的附加内容。带有数字墨水标记语言元素的标记语言文档被传送到存储设备。根据一个或多个方面,对存储设本文档来自技高网...
在标记语言文档中支持数字墨水

【技术保护点】
一种方法,包括:由应用接收针对标记语言文档的数字墨水用户输入;生成包括描述数字墨水用户输入的数据的数字墨水标记语言元素;把数字墨水标记语言元素嵌入在标记语言文档中,所述标记语言文档还在一个或多个附加元素中包括描述在显示标记语言文档时将显示的附加内容的附加数据,以便允许把描述数字墨水用户输入的数据和描述附加内容的附加数据包括在单一文件中;以及把带有数字墨水标记语言元素的标记语言文档传送到存储设备。

【技术特征摘要】
【国外来华专利技术】2015.02.10 US 14/6183031.一种方法,包括:由应用接收针对标记语言文档的数字墨水用户输入;生成包括描述数字墨水用户输入的数据的数字墨水标记语言元素;把数字墨水标记语言元素嵌入在标记语言文档中,所述标记语言文档还在一个或多个附加元素中包括描述在显示标记语言文档时将显示的附加内容的附加数据,以便允许把描述数字墨水用户输入的数据和描述附加内容的附加数据包括在单一文件中;以及把带有数字墨水标记语言元素的标记语言文档传送到存储设备。2.根据权利要求1所述的方法,还包括在标记语言文档中保留数字墨水和附加内容的z顺序。3.根据权利要求1或权利要求2所述的方法,所述应用显示将在其中输入数字墨水的编辑框,数字墨水用户输入既包括编辑框内的多个位置也包括编辑框之外的多个位置,所述方法还包括:在数字墨水标记语言元素中包括既标识出编辑框内的多个位置也标识出编辑框之外的多个位置的数据;以及显示仅编辑框内的多个位置,作为针对数字墨水用户输入的数字墨水笔划。4.根据权利要求1到3当中的任一条所述的方法,还包括:使用一个或多个第一程序线程来接收数字墨水用户输入并且显示针对数字墨水用户输入的数字墨水笔划;以及使用一个或多个第二程序线程来显示附加内容。5.根据权利要求1到4当中的任一条所述的方法,还包括:在接收到数字墨水用户输入之后接收针对撤消数字墨水用户输入的第一用户请求;以及响应于第一用户请求,从标记语言文档中移除数字墨水标记语言元素。6.根据权利要求5所述的方法,还包括:在接收到针对撤消数字墨水用户输入的第一用户请求之后接收针对重做数字墨水用户输入的第二请求;以及响应于第二用户请求,把数字墨水标记语言元素添加回到标记语言文档中。7.根据权利要求1到6当中的任一条所述的方法,还包括:在接收到数字墨水用户输入之后接收针对擦除数字墨水的一部分的用户请求;以及从数字墨水标记语言元素中删除标识出对应于所述部分的数字墨水的位置的数据。8.根据权利要求1到7当中的任一条所述的方法,还包括:接收规定数字墨水的特性的用户输入,所述特性包括从包括以下各项的一组当中选择的一项或多项特性:形状、颜色和宽度;以及在数字墨水标记语言元素中添加标识出用户规定的数字墨水特性的附加元素。9.根据权利要求1到8当中的任一条所述的方法,还包括:辨识数字墨水用户输入所表示的一个或多个字符;以及在数字墨水标记...

【专利技术属性】
技术研发人员:苏飞EC布朗涂霄
申请(专利权)人:微软技术许可有限责任公司
类型:发明
国别省市:美国,US

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1